Getting There

  • Public Transport

    From Recife, take a bus from Terminal Cais Santa Rita to Rua José Braz Da Silva 47a in Suape. The bus journey takes approximately 33 minutes, with buses departing hourly. From there, it's a short walk to the beach. The ticket costs between R$8 and R$14.

  • Taxi/Ride-share

    A taxi or ride-share from Recife to Praia de Suape typically takes around 41 minutes. Expect to pay between R$200 and R$250 for the trip. Alternatively, a taxi from Suape Port to Recife costs approximately R$260–R$320.

  • Driving

    Driving from Recife to Suape takes about 41 minutes via the PE-060. The driving distance is approximately 41 kilometers. Parking is available near the beach, though spaces are limited. Paid parking is available at the entrance.

Discover more about Praia de Suape

Praia de Suape is a beautiful beach situated in the municipality of Cabo de Santo Agostinho, in the state of Pernambuco, Brazil. Located a few kilometers from the Suape Port Complex, it lies between Praia do Paraíso and the Massangana River. The beach is surrounded by native vegetation and numerous coconut trees, offering a tranquil escape with its expansive shoreline, soft sands, and clear waters. The beach is known for the natural pools formed by sandstone reefs, making it ideal for swimming and water sports. The calm, crystal-clear waters are perfect for bathing and practicing nautical sports like windsurfing and jet skiing. The lush nature, white sandy shores, and reefs teeming with marine life make it a paradise for nature lovers. Praia de Suape is a popular destination for families with young children and those who appreciate peaceful holidays. The beach offers good infrastructure, including bars, restaurants, hotels, and pousadas (Brazilian inns). Visitors can enjoy local seafood dishes at one of the beach bars for an authentic culinary experience. The beach's peninsula location creates unique tidal patterns, ideal for tide pool exploration. The area's coconut palms and mangroves support diverse birdlife, including herons and kingfishers.
